ML310E Gen8 V2 - AMS Service Error on Debian/Ubuntu

I keep getting the below error every second after installing the HP Agentless Management Service on Debian 7 / Ubuntu Server 14.04.2 LTS

 

Loading kernel module for a network device with CAP_SYS_MODULE (deprecated).  Use CAP_NET_ADMIN and alias netdev- instead.

 The service installs without error from HP repository, however  the network apadters and storgae device are not being reported in iLo. The status is unknown for each device.

Jimmy Vance
HPE Pro

Re: ML310E Gen8 V2 - AMS Service Error on Debian/Ubuntu

If you are running the disk controller in AHCI mode, iLO cannot display any data about storage. For the embedded HP Ethernet 1Gb 2-port 332i Adapter you need the hp-tg3sd agent
